The story of Charles Henry Griffith began in 1902 in Atlantic City, New Jersey, USA. In 1910, Charles Henry Griffith resided in North Wildwood, Cape May, New Jersey, USA. In 1920, Charles Henry Griffith resided in Lower, Cape May, New Jersey, USA. Charles Henry Griffith married Elma Irene Smith, and had children including Harry Bert Griffith, Myrna I Griffith, Rose Kathleen Griffith. Charles Henry Griffith passed away in 1985 in Lynne, Marion County, Florida, USA.
